Join the Chamber of Commerce Hawaii, Central Pacific Bank, and a panel of experts for a discussion about How to Obtain Financing to Help Your Business Grow.
Moderator:
Sharene Urakami-Oyama, Vice President, Small Business Market Manager
Central Pacific Bank
Sharene Urakami-Oyama is Vice President & Small Business Market Manager at Central Pacific Bank (CPB). Sharene began her banking career at a large national financial institution prior to joining CPB and has over 30 years of combined retail and banking experience. She earned her Bachelor of Arts from the University of Hawaii at Manoa through an athletic scholarship. Sharene is passionate about serving her community and is a board member for the University of Hawaii Alumni Association, the University of Hawaii Letterwinners Club and the Kaimuki-Waialae YMCA. She is also a troop leader for the Girl Scouts of Hawaii.
Speaker 1:
Dennis Wong, Senior Business Consultant
Hawaii Small Business Development Center
Dennis has 41 years of financial experience (including many years at the senior managerial level). Graduate of the Advanced Commercial Lending Graduate School in Oklahoma and Pacific Coast Banking School in Seattle. He has assisted businesses in many different industries including manufacturing, distribution, wholesale, retail, service, hospitality, agriculture, and restaurants. Also, he is a Board of Director for Hawaii Green Infrastructure Authority and has been a long time advisory council member of the SBA, worked extensively with the USDA, and HEDCO 504 loan program.
Speaker 2:
Michael Kim, Vice President & Business Banking Team Manager
Central Pacific Bank
Michael Kim is Vice President & Business Banking Team Manager at Central Pacific Bank. Michael has been with Central Pacific Bank since 2008 during which time he has worked with all types of small businesses and specializes in medical professionals. Michael has a Bachelor of Science degree in Business Administration with an emphasis in Finance, from the University of Hawaii at Manoa Shidler College of Business and is a graduate of Pacific Coast Banking School at the University of Washington. Michael is a board member of Aloha Medical Mission serving as its Treasurer.
